Sonic Healthcare USA, part of Sonic Healthcare Limited--one of the world's largest diagnostic laboratory medicine companies--seeks a visionary Chief Information Officer (CIO). Our mission is to enhance health and well-being through high-quality laboratory information and a unique Medical Leadership model across our regional labs in the United States.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Lead the transformation of the IT function to support anatomic and clinical pathology operations in a federated structure.

  • Develop and implement an agile IT strategy that integrates and consolidates systems across laboratory operations.

  • Collaborate with the executive team to prioritize initiatives that align IT with business goals.

  • Reshape the IT organizational structure, ensuring it meets modernization and business needs.

  • Work with Sonic Healthcare's global technology team to adopt international standards and leverage economies of scale.

  • Oversee technology transformation initiatives to boost operational efficiency, scalability, and service delivery.

  • Ensure data interoperability and seamless workflows through system consolidation and integration.

  • Foster a culture of excellence and collaboration within the IT function.

  • Manage IT risks, including cybersecurity, disaster recovery, and compliance.

  • Oversee the IT budget and vendor relationships, and lead the selection and implementation of enterprise systems.

  • Stay informed on emerging technologies that can enhance operational and competitive advantages.

Required Skills and Experience:

  • Proven IT leadership experience in healthcare, preferably within clinical or anatomic pathology settings.

  • Demonstrated success in driving operational efficiency through technology in complex, multi-location environments.

  • Strong collaborative, communication, and leadership skills, with the ability to engage diverse stakeholders.

  • Deep understanding of software development, systems integration, and data management, especially in international contexts.

Education:

  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Systems, Engineering, or a related field required.

  • Master's degree in Business Administration or Healthcare Administration preferred.

  • Minimum of 10 years of progressive IT leadership experience, including prior CIO or equivalent roles.
